Science Verification Results from PMAS
PMAS, the Potsdam Multi-Aperture Spectrophotometer, is a new integral field
instrument which was commissioned at the Calar Alto 3.5m Telescope in May 2001.
We report on results obtained from a science verification run in October 2001.
We present observations of the low-metallicity blue compact dwarf galaxy
SBS0335-052, the ultra-luminous X-ray Source X-1 in the Holmberg II galaxy, the
quadruple gravitational lens system Q2237+0305 (the "Einstein Cross"), the
Galactic planetary nebula NGC7027, and extragalactic planetary nebulae in M31.
